About Chiltern Grange Care Home

Chiltern Grange Care Home is a nursing home in High Wycombe, in the Buckinghamshire council area, registered with the Care Quality Commission for up to 75 residents. It provides care for people living with dementia, older people and younger adults. It is run by Porthaven Care Homes, which operates 19 care homes in England. The home has been registered since February 2013.

At its latest inspection, published February 2018, the CQC rated Chiltern Grange Care Home Good, which means the CQC found the service performing well and meeting its expectations. Ratings can change after a new inspection, so check the CQC report before you visit.

Chiltern Grange Care Home has not published its fees and has not yet confirmed them to us. Care homes in Buckinghamshire with a fee on record typically charge about £1,438 a week for residential care and £1,700 for nursing care, so expect a figure in that range and ask the home for a written quote.

There are 133 registered care homes in Buckinghamshire. The nearest to Chiltern Grange Care Home include Alpha Community Care, Penley Grange and Penley View, 1 of which has a fee on record. A live-in carer at home, an alternative many families compare, costs from about £1,120 a week.

Does Chiltern Grange Care Home provide nursing care?

Yes. Chiltern Grange Care Home is registered as a care home with nursing, so registered nurses are on site. If you need nursing care the NHS pays a weekly contribution towards the nursing part of the fee.
